My newest piece. The front piece is PMC - which is Precious metal clay.
You roll it, texture it, shape it, then put it in a kiln at 1650 degrees for 2 hours. The clay "binder" is burned out completely leaving you with a piece of pure (.999) silver.
It's been riveted with stainless steel bolts connecting to an etched copper sheet, cut to match the front.
An electroformed lampwork acorn bead dangle.

A new acorn style. I used enamels for the colors. Enamels are finely ground glass that is like a powder, but creates some intense colors. I wear a respirator when I use them because I don't want to inhale little glass particles. Yuck !
